// ARCHIVE_AFTER_DAYS controls when Frostvault moves cold storage buckets
// into the deep-archive tier. Lowering this value triggers mass copy jobs
// and can saturate the transfer pool for hours, so coordinate with the
// storage rotation before changing it. Buckets tagged `legal-hold` are
// always skipped regardless of this setting. If archival stalls, check
// the mover daemon logs first, not the scheduler. When filing an incident,
// include the build token that appears on the line below.

pipeline stamp: htk31_f769b577b3028a4e9958e5bb8d1259a

**Action item: right-size the Quarrystone connection pool**

During Tuesday's incident the Quarrystone API exhausted its database connection pool under moderate load because each worker held connections across external calls. We will cap pool size per instance, add a checkout timeout with alerting, and move long-running report queries to the replica pool. Owner: platform team, target end of sprint. Pool sizing math, the new timeout values, and dashboards for monitoring saturation are collected on the internal page below.

wiki page, tahaf-tajog: https://jira.ordindyn.corp/pipeline

Welcome aboard. The Herald notification service fans out one event to up to 200k device endpoints. To keep downstream push gateways healthy, we enforce per-tenant quotas and a global concurrency ceiling. When the pending queue crosses the high-water mark, the dispatcher sheds low-priority tenants first, then applies uniform throttling. Do not raise tenant quotas without checking gateway headroom on the Mirelle dashboard; most incidents last quarter came from exactly that. The enforced limits are as follows.

tuning table, kahop-fahog:
RATE_LIMITS = {
    "wenix": 1,
    "druael": 10,
    "holix": 1,
    "zorael": 1,
}

## Changelog — userd 2.0.0

Extracted the user module from the Brindlecore monolith into the standalone userd service. Defaults changed: session TTL now 30m (was 12h), password hashing moved to argon2, profile cache disabled by default. Review the diff against the old inline config. The new service ships with these defaults:

deployment values, kajep-kageg:
[praix]
host = praix.paliqcorp.corp
user = praix_svc
database = praix_prod